Planning Phase

This phase transforms research evidence into strategies through a four-session stakeholder workshop.

Neighborhood Level:
Three sessions document the workshop process.
Session 1, Gap Finder: introduces the case and the research findings to target groups. Using the Data Viewer and urban health cards, participants experience an immersive pedestrian experience at the site.

Session 2, Urban Diagnostics: the environmental evidence informs pedestrian surveys for slower-paced users. The qualitative information complements the quantitative approach.

Session 3, Planning:
uses three sustainability boards to align climate, health, and economic goals, producing a Planning Brief.

Street Level:
Session 4, Design: translates the Planning Brief into before and after spatial proposals at street level along Pedestrian Loop 2.
